1. Initial Consultation and Assessment
The first step in professional electrical panels installation is a thorough consultation and assessment of your home’s electrical needs. An experienced electrician will evaluate the size of your home, the number of electrical appliances, and your overall power demand to determine the appropriate panel size and type.
When you hire electrical panels installation in Cook County, IL, the electrician will:
- Assess your home’s current electrical system
- Identify any existing issues or safety concerns
- Help you choose the best panel type (e.g., 100 amp, 200 amp, etc.)
- Discuss your home’s future electrical needs (such as additional appliances or devices)
By starting with a comprehensive evaluation, you ensure that the new electrical panel will be properly sized to handle your current and future power needs.

3. Expert Installation and Setup
Once everything is in place, the professional electricians will proceed with the installation of your new electrical panel. They will follow the necessary steps to ensure everything is connected correctly, safely, and efficiently.
Here’s what happens during the installation:
- Shut down of the main power supply: The electricity will be turned off during the installation process to ensure safety.
- Panel mounting: The new electrical panel will be securely mounted in the appropriate location, according to local building codes.
- Wire connections: The electricians will connect the various circuits from your home to the new panel, ensuring everything is properly wired.
- Breaker installation: Circuit breakers will be installed and labeled clearly for easy identification.
By hiring electrical panels installation in Cook County, IL, you ensure that the panel is set up correctly, minimizing the risk of future issues like electrical overloads or short circuits.
4. Testing and Quality Assurance
After the electrical panel is installed, professional electricians conduct thorough testing to ensure that everything is functioning properly. They will check for:
- Correct voltage and amperage
- Proper breaker placement and labeling
- No wiring issues or potential hazards
- Correct grounding to prevent shocks or electrocution
This final testing phase ensures that your new electrical panel is safe and fully operational, preventing electrical hazards that could put your home and family at risk.
5. Safety Inspections and Code Compliance
An essential part of professional electrical panels installation in Cook County, IL is ensuring that the installation meets both local and national electrical codes. These codes are in place to protect your home from electrical hazards and ensure your system runs efficiently.
A licensed electrician will perform a safety inspection to ensure that:
- The installation meets the National Electrical Code (NEC)
- The panel and wiring comply with Cook County’s local regulations
- Proper grounding and bonding are in place to prevent electrical shock
If your installation is part of a larger renovation or new construction project, the electrician may also work with local authorities to obtain necessary permits and schedule a final inspection.
